Openwin Error
1.I was trying to use Exceed to run Solaris "openwin" on my Windows 95. I got an error :
/usr/openwin/bin/openwin & [1] 28522 $ /dev/fb: No such file or directory Graphics Adapter device /dev/fb is of unknown type Fatal server error: InitOutput: Error loading module for /dev/fb Does this mean I have a bad Graphic card or anything else? If I need to replace this card, what's the correct type? My Solaris box is Ultra Enterprise 450. 2. I tried to run it using another solaris box, this one gave me an error: /usr/openwin/bin/openwin & 11056 $ openwin: There is already a server running on :0 What do I need to do with this?
